Upgrading Memory (Optional)

These descriptions are for models with a memory compartment cover. For the replacement or upgrade procedures for the memory of models that do not have a memory compartment cover, please ask for assistance from your service center.

There are 1 or 2 memory slots according to the model’s speciication and users can replace the installed memory or add a new memory.

Replace or install a new memory module only after shutting the computer down completely and separating the AC adapter from the computer.

It is recommended to add memory with the same speciications (the same manufacturer and capacity) as that of the installed memory.

The images used for the illustration are of a representative model, therefore the images may difer from the the actual product.

Adding or Replacing Memory Modules

1 computer.Disconnect the AC power adapter after turning of the

2

Insert an object, such as a paper clip, into the Emergency

Hole at the bottom of the computer to cut the battery power.

If the Power button does not work anymore, that means you successfully shut the power of.

If you proceed without pressing the Emergency Hole, the main board and the memory module may be damaged.

Emergency Hole

The location of the Emergency Battery Hole may difer depending on the model.
